

如果您无法下载资料,请参考说明:
1、部分资料下载需要金币,请确保您的账户上有足够的金币
2、已购买过的文档,再次下载不重复扣费
3、资料包下载后请先用软件解压,在使用对应软件打开
基于BitTorrent的流媒体系统激励机制研究 概述 基于BitTorrent的流媒体系统是一种分布式的流媒体传输系统,它利用点对点网络技术实现高效的数据传输。这种系统可以在广泛的应用场景下提供高质量、无间断的视频流服务。然而,这种系统面临着一些保障它可靠运行的挑战。其中之一是系统的激励机制,这将是本文研究的重点。 BitTorrent的流媒体系统的优点 BitTorrent的流媒体系统具有以下优点: 高效的数据传输:BitTorrent的流媒体系统使用点对点网络技术,利用每个参与者的带宽来传输数据,大大提高了数据传输效率,减少了服务器的负载。 可扩展性:系统的参与者数量可以随时增加或减少,从而适应不同的负载需求,保证系统具有较高的可扩展性。 容错性:由于所有参与者都可以参与数据的传输和分发,系统的容错性很高。如果某个参与者离开,其他参与者可以自动接替其工作,保障数据传输的连续性。 研究中可能面临的问题 BitTorrent的流媒体系统面临的问题包括: 低素质参与者:由于每个参与者都可以参与数据的传输和分发,导致可能存在一些低素质参与者,这些参与者可能会传输错误或不完整的数据,或者根本不进行数据传输,这会影响整个系统的稳定性和可靠性。 没有感知传输特征的参与者:数据的传输和分发是根据用户要求进行的。如果用户数量增加,每个参与者收到的请求将会增加,从而导致一些参与者的负载增加,而另一些参与者的负载减少。然而,由于参与者的工作是自由的,没有强制性的规则,参与者难以感知其负载和各自的特点,这可能会导致参与者不能合理分配数据的传输和分发。 激励机制 激励机制是关键因素,可确保系统的高效运行和保护参与者的利益。在BitTorrent的流媒体系统中,激励机制由以下两个方面的因素构成: 基于奖励的机制:在BitTorrent的流媒体系统中,参与者可以按照其数据传输的速度或以其他方式获得奖励。可以采用一些基于奖励的机制,如将数据分发到不同的部分,根据数量和时间计算参与者的值,并以此为基础获得奖励,以保持系统的良好运行。 基于惩罚的机制:为确保系统的正常运行,参与者需要遵循制定的规则和规定。如果参与者不遵守规定,可能会有惩罚措施,例如降低其参与的数据上传速度等措施,以确保系统的稳定性。 总结 BitTorrent的流媒体系统是一种高效、可扩展、容错性高的分布式系统。激励机制是保障其高效运行的关键因素,可以基于奖励和惩罚措施来确保参与者的主动性和奉献精神。未来,需要进一步完善和优化该系统的激励机制,从而保障其可靠性、可扩展性和高效性,实现更好地服务于广大用户的需求。

快乐****蜜蜂
实名认证
内容提供者


最近下载